## Roberto Firmino Scores Hat-Trick on Al Ahli Debut as Saudi Pro League Kicks Off
The Saudi Pro League has kicked off with a dash of star power, as former Liverpool striker Roberto Firmino scored a hat-trick on his Al Ahli debut. The 31-year-old, who was handed the captain’s armband, netted twice in the first nine minutes and rounded off the scoring midway through the second half as Al Ahli beat Al Hazem 3-1 in Jeddah.
The oil-rich Gulf state has attracted a host of big-name players from Europe’s top clubs, including Premier League stalwarts and Champions League winners, in a trolley dash worth almost half a billion US dollars leading up to the 2023/24 campaign. Firmino arrived as a well-paid free transfer from Anfield and enjoyed a memorable start as he linked up with fellow imports Riyad Mahrez and Allan Saint-Maximin.
There was an assist apiece for former Manchester City winger Mahrez and Newcastle old boy Saint-Maximin, but not all of Al Ahli’s high-profile acquisitions excelled. Edouard Mendy, the former Chelsea goalkeeper, was enjoying a quiet evening until he side-footed a clearance straight to opposition forward Vina and found himself chipped from 25 yards as he scrambled back into position. Fortunately, the error did not cost the home side, who were promoted last season and are one of several sides to have built a star-studded squad with the assistance of the Saudi Public Investment Fund.
Firmino opened his account with a powerful near-post header in the sixth minute and doubled his tally soon after when Saint-Maximin sprayed a pass wide for Mahrez, who left the striker a close-range tap-in. He made the match ball his own in the 72nd minute when his headed effort from Saint-Maximin’s curling cross was saved, hooking his leg round to finish on the rebound.
Firmino has been joined in the league by his former Liverpool team-mates Jordan Henderson, Fabinho and Sadio Mane, while Cristiano Ronaldo, Karim Benzema and N’Golo Kante also take their place among the A-list cast of recruits.
